Wildlife Viewing in Pagosa Country

Wildlife viewing opportunities are abundant in the Pagosa Springs area and almost guaranteed if you venture off the beaten path, whether on a hike or during a scenic drive into the surrounding national forest. 

To guarantee sighting most of the area's wildlife, check out the Rocky Mountain Wildlife Park.  The park  is a great place to see wildlife up close, with a half mile trail that wanders around the large, natural landscape with cages that house bears, mountain lions, bobcats, coyotes, wolves and elk.  The Park is located a few miles east of Pagosa Springs on Hwy 84.  Stop by the Pagosa Springs Visitor Center and grab a brochure or call 970-264-5546 for more information. 

Another option is to take a ride on the Cumbres & Toltec Scenic Railroad, located in Chama, NM, only 45 miles away.  Large herds of elk are often seen from the train.   

The San Juan mountains and Pagosa area are also home to a variety of birds.  Many types can be found during a drive on the beautiful Piedra Road.
